Bayern's Diaz Dilemma: A Three-Game Ban Gets a Fight Backed by Fire and a 6-2 Bundesliga Masterclass

Bayern Munich plans to challenge the three-match suspension given to Louis Diaz by UEFA after a red card in a Champions League clash with Paris Saint-Germain. Club officials argue the punishment is overly harsh and that reasoning from UEFA will determine the path of the appeal. Meanwhile, Bayern roared back in the Bundesliga by crushing Freiburg 6-2, with Lennart Karl starring and a string of record-breaking stats. The side now shifts its focus to a daunting run of fixtures, including Arsenal, as it presses toward silverware on multiple fronts. Renaissance Berkane Sets the Pace: A 3-0 Masterclass Against Dynamos in Africa’s Spotlight

Renaissance Berkane opened their CAF Champions League campaign with a convincing 3-0 win over Power Dynamos. The Moroccan champions showcased control and clinical finishing, signaling serious continental ambitions. Key moments included an own goal, a smart finish from Monir Shouair, and a late penalty sealed by Paul Valery. The result places Berkane at the forefront of their group alongside Pyramids, as they eye a deep run in Africa’s premier club competition. Spalletti Calls for a Higher Gear After Florence Draw

Juventus were held 1-1 by Fiorentina in round 12 of Serie A, with Kostič's late first-half strike sandwiched by Mandragora's equaliser. The result keeps Juve in 7th place on 20 points, extending a run of draws. Spalletti urged his team to lift their level and warned that the path to the Scudetto demands more discipline and quality. The match was also overshadowed by racist chants toward Vlahović, prompting referee intervention and a stern response from Fiorentina’s captain.

Early Thunder at Camp Nou: Barça’s 4-0 Domination over Bilbao Sparks a La Liga Show

Barcelona returned to Camp Nou and unleashed a commanding 4-0 victory over Athletic Bilbao. Ferran Torres hit a brace, with Fermín López and Robert Lewandowski adding the others. The win lifts Barça to the top of La Liga temporarily, ahead on goal difference. Bilbao pressed hard but couldn’t contain the Catalan attack, while Barça’s defense tightened after a late red card. Two-Nil Triumph Keeps Cleopatra on Top of the Egyptian Premier League

Ceramica Cleopatra solidified their place at the summit of the Egyptian Premier League by beating Pharco 2-0 away at Borg El Arab. Goals came from Hussein Al-Sayed and Justus Arthur, sealing a hard-fought victory. The win lifts Cleopatra to 29 points, six clear of the reigning champions Al Ahly, while Pharco remain in the relegation zone. The match showcased solid defensive work from Pharco and tactical tweaks from Cleopatra. Nassr's Joker Returns Ahead of Gulf Clash

Al-Nassr’s Ayman Yahya is cleared to play against Al-Khaleej in Round 9 of the Roshen Saudi Pro League after recovering from injury. The leaders face a stern test from a Gulf side in strong form under Georgios Donis. Yahya, a versatile wing-back, has featured 12 times this season with one goal in 763 minutes. Joshua King of Al-Khaleej is reportedly doubtful with a muscle tear, while Nassr’s lineup remains stacked with quality across the board.

Hat-Trick Cat Sparks Pyramids to a 3-0 Thrashing of Rivers United in CAF CL Opener

Pyramids FC thrashed Rivers United 3-0 in the CAF Champions League group opener in Cairo. Ahmed Atef, nicknamed Cat, scored a hat-trick to seal the win. Rivers United struggled to convert chances as Pyramids pressed relentlessly. Jurčić's men seize early control of the group, showcasing clinical finishing. The match highlighted Pyramids' attacking prowess and Rivers United's defensive gaps.

Back in the Game: Pogba’s 26-Month Comeback with Monaco Sparks a New Chapter

Paul Pogba makes a long-awaited comeback for Monaco after a 26-month absence. Once a World Cup winner and a fixture for France, his career faced a suspension that was reduced on appeal. He signed a two-year deal with Monaco in 2025 and debuted as a late substitute in a 4-1 defeat at Rennes. The result leaves Monaco eighth in Ligue 1 as Pogba eyes a steady return to top form. His comeback is watched as a test of whether elite talent can rebound after lengthy downtime.

Erbil Extends Lead as Karama and Al-Quwa Al-Jawiya Deliver Key Wins in the Iraqi Premier League

Erbil strengthened its position at the top of the Iraqi Premier League with a 2-1 victory over Graaf, thanks to a late Timirov penalty. Karama and Al-Quwa Al-Jawiya also secured important wins, keeping the title race tightly contested. Diyala rallied to beat Al-Kahraba 2-1, while Al-Minaa and Najaf suffered defeats elsewhere. The round also featured a postponement of Round 8 to accommodate national team preparations for the Arab Cup in Qatar.

Zamalek's Bold Plea: Labib Urges Sisi to Crack Oct 6 Land Crisis—Paperwork Proven Solid

Hussein Labib, Zamalek's chairman, appeals to President Sisi to resolve the Oct 6 land dispute, insisting the club's documents are in order. His deputy, Hisham Nasser, acknowledges communication missteps but reaffirms resolve. The sports minister counters with reassurance that the state is watching closely and will not abandon Zamalek. Late Penalty Seals Dramatic Win for Al Hilal Over Al Fateh

Al Hilal clinched a 2-1 victory over Al Fateh in the Saudi Pro League, with a late penalty converted by Ruben Neves. The win lifts Hilal to 23 points, temporarily securing second place, while Fateh remain near the bottom of the table. Koulibaly and Bono praised the team’s spirit and resolve after going behind. Looking ahead, Hilal faces a crowded run of domestic cups and continental fixtures that will test their depth and focus as the season heats up.
